WebGet an estimate from your service and set up a payment plan or pay lump sum. You have essential 4 years from when you start federal employment to buy back your time. If you fail to pay it all off, they charge G fund rate of interest for a given year you still have a balance. You can do a payroll deduction to pay it off. You need a minimum of 5 years of civilian service to be eligible for a civilian retirement annuity. However, after the 5 years is met, the military service is creditable towards years of service for all the other voluntary retirement eligibility requirements: MRA +10; MRA +30; 60 ... bobbin fill thread
